Course Content

• Understanding Diverse Learners in STEM: Neurodiversity, IEPs, and Differentiated Instruction
• Inquiry-Based Learning Models for Special Needs: Project-Based Learning, Problem-Based Learning, and Experiential Learning
• Universal Design for Learning (UDL) in STEM: Accessibility and Assistive Technology
• Adapting STEM Curriculum and Assessment for Special Needs: Modifications and Accommodations
• Integrating Technology for STEM Inquiry-Based Learning: Assistive technology and digital tools for special needs students
• Data-Driven Instruction and Progress Monitoring in STEM: Assessing student learning and adjusting instruction
• Collaborative Teaching and Co-Teaching Strategies for Inclusive STEM Classrooms
• Building a Supportive and Inclusive STEM Learning Environment: Classroom management and social-emotional learning
• Implementing STEM Inquiry-Based Learning for Students with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D)
• Ethical Considerations in STEM Education for Special Needs Students

Career path

Career Role (STEM Inquiry-Based Learning, Special Needs) Description
Special Educational Needs (SEN) Teacher (Primary/Secondary) Develop and deliver engaging STEM curriculum tailored to diverse learners, emphasizing inquiry-based methods. High demand in UK schools.
Learning Support Assistant (LSA) – STEM Focus Provide direct support to students with SEN in STEM subjects, fostering inquiry and practical skills. Growing sector with varied roles.
Educational Psychologist (SEN & STEM Expertise) Assess learning needs, design interventions, and advise educators on inclusive STEM practices. Specialized role with strong career prospects.
STEM Curriculum Developer (SEN Adaptation) Create and adapt STEM resources and programs for special needs students using inquiry-based approaches. High demand with specialized skills.
Inclusion Specialist (STEM Focus) Champion inclusive practices in STEM education, train staff, and ensure equitable access to STEM for all learners. Emerging field with significant growth potential.
